Search Wiki:

Welcome to the All-In-One Code Framework!

Project Site:

Microsoft All-In-One Code Framework delineates the framework and skeleton of Microsoft development techniques through typical sample codes in three popular programming languages (Visual C#, VB.NET, Visual C++). Each sample is elaborately selected, composed, and documented to demonstrate one frequently-asked, tested or used coding scenario based on our support experience in MSDN newsgroups and forums. If you are a software developer, you can fill the skeleton with blood, muscle and soul. If you are a software tester or a support engineer like us, you may extend the sample codes a little to fit your specific test scenario or refer your customer to this project if the customer's question coincides with what we collected.

Today is March 12th, 2010. The project has more than 360 code examples that cover 24 Microsoft development technologies like Azure, Windows 7 and Silverlight 3. The collection grows by six samples per week. You can find the up-to-date list of samples in All-In-One Code Framework Sample Catalog.


The above six features are highlighted because most sample code sites like and MSDN do not have them. Besides, the code examples in All-In-One Code Framework are typical, extensible, structured, complete, well-documented and easy to understand.




Propose a New Sample

The sample proposal process is simple. All you have to do is to fill out a one-page All-In-One Code Framework Sample Proposal.dotx document which provides us with information needed to determine if the sample fits the project. Once you fill out the proposal, please send the document to: Project Feedback.

Special Thanks!

To All-In-One Code Framework Review Heroes who gave very constructive feedback to the project: romans01 ; rhencke ; Mike4Online .

To Fisnik Hasani in Sweden who designed the beautiful project logo for the project!
To Laurent Duveau (Microsoft MVP) for his promotion of the work!
To David Thielen who works for Windward Reports for adding All-In-One Code Framework to his Best Programming Tools list.


We look forward to hearing your feedback. Please post your suggestions and ideas in Discussions or contact us directly. Your comments on this project are appreciated.


-MSDN Forum Support Team 2010-03-12
Last edited Mar 14 2010 at 3:44 AM  by Jialiang, version 5
Page view tracker